A study has examined the use of potentially inappropriate medicines (PIMs) on hospitalisation rates, and also estimated the rate of hospitalisation during exposure to individual PIMs in older adults.1 The authors point out that inappropriate medicines pose a particular risk to older people due to cognitive and physiological changes associated with the ageing process.
